Medium-sized
hotels have been opened in the Vietnamese countryside to accomodate
visitors traveling to areas outside the urban centers such as Hanoi and Ho Chi
Minh City. Victoria Hotels and Resorts, a French company with Vietnamese partners,
is responsible for opening the hotels from late 1998 through 1999 in places
such as Phan Thiet, 80 miles east of Ho Chi Minh City on the coast and Chau
Doc and Can Tho in the Mekong Delta. The hotels have 50 to 93 rooms each and
rates average $80 but are frequently negotiable when booked through a travel
agent in Vietnam. (David Lamb, Los Angeles Times, January 16, 2000)
